8 Commits

Author SHA256 Message Date
9036a1ae6b Accepting request 1329022 from KDE:Extra
Update to 26.1.20

OBS-URL: https://build.opensuse.org/request/show/1329022
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/skrooge?expand=0&rev=20
2026-01-26 10:04:51 +00:00
Christophe Marin
452d51d13c OBS-URL: https://build.opensuse.org/package/show/KDE:Extra/skrooge?expand=0&rev=163 2026-01-24 19:33:32 +00:00
b4458f6799 Accepting request 1312204 from KDE:Extra
Update to 25.10.0

OBS-URL: https://build.opensuse.org/request/show/1312204
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/skrooge?expand=0&rev=19
2025-10-20 11:35:16 +00:00
Christophe Marin
0c06582555 OBS-URL: https://build.opensuse.org/package/show/KDE:Extra/skrooge?expand=0&rev=161 2025-10-19 09:23:07 +00:00
Christophe Marin
987dc67da5 Update to 25.10.0
OBS-URL: https://build.opensuse.org/package/show/KDE:Extra/skrooge?expand=0&rev=160
2025-10-19 09:17:59 +00:00
3294e1fcda Accepting request 1311094 from KDE:Extra
- Add patch:
  * 0001-Fix-build-with-Qt-6.10.patch

OBS-URL: https://build.opensuse.org/request/show/1311094
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/skrooge?expand=0&rev=18
2025-10-13 13:36:14 +00:00
Christophe Marin
40cf54799b OBS-URL: https://build.opensuse.org/package/show/KDE:Extra/skrooge?expand=0&rev=158 2025-10-13 11:21:56 +00:00
Christophe Marin
35f04cd147 - Add patch:
* 0001-Fix-build-with-Qt-6.10.patch

OBS-URL: https://build.opensuse.org/package/show/KDE:Extra/skrooge?expand=0&rev=157
2025-10-13 11:15:50 +00:00
6 changed files with 59 additions and 17 deletions

View File

@@ -1,3 +0,0 @@
version https://git-lfs.github.com/spec/v1
oid sha256:1cdba2fd28c237d2d6c54c470da7b9f67e6a3c8c185875f5b854a5567c0194bf
size 23334240

View File

@@ -1,7 +0,0 @@
-----BEGIN PGP SIGNATURE-----
iHUEABYKAB0WIQTxlV7Z0cLRDYCzGzsU7jfNFcU73QUCaAqUIgAKCRAU7jfNFcU7
3R40AQDHV8T0ItTQJgQgbp8ovBgM0aTotF4JSXwjiif3SxV1CQD+JFBoTIExVG5Y
pBJ21YduD+N8W/hLht0bCTFXSLkeDAA=
=kw8p
-----END PGP SIGNATURE-----

3
skrooge-26.1.20.tar.xz Normal file
View File

@@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:d986ff54640661095c40f2eba43d9918809514c89da9e6695d35ffd137aca096
size 25661532

View File

@@ -0,0 +1,7 @@
-----BEGIN PGP SIGNATURE-----
iHUEABYKAB0WIQTxlV7Z0cLRDYCzGzsU7jfNFcU73QUCaW+aIwAKCRAU7jfNFcU7
3dlTAP49QnUmdOMedvg9PabQtiPVspxabU5ciX7CjLrMt7XrdgEA25Y46JkPf/0Z
sYpvdmrrja8U3xi4ZrgzxCztZcMquwM=
=mWd2
-----END PGP SIGNATURE-----

View File

@@ -1,3 +1,47 @@
-------------------------------------------------------------------
Sat Jan 24 19:31:37 UTC 2026 - Christophe Marin <christophe@krop.fr>
- Update to 26.1.20
* (kde# 512770)some accounts doubled in "amount" vs "today
amount"
* kde#513589: QIF import errors
* kde#513016: skrooge-boursorama.py don't work
* kde#514649: Performance issue
* kde#514649: "Open transaction with..." and some other are
empty
-------------------------------------------------------------------
Sun Oct 19 09:12:19 UTC 2025 - Christophe Marin <christophe@krop.fr>
- Update to 25.10.0
* kde#479854: The tool "Align sub-operation date..." don't update
an operation
* kde#498606: '##WARNING: QFSFileEngine::open: No file name
specified'
* kde#507235: bad Unit import for Ms Money
* kde#507414: Regression: Error importing ISO20022 XML into
Skrooge
* kde#510022: MS Money import: Dividends cause Unit Value = 0
* kde#510025: MS Money import: split transaction comments
lost/overwritten
* kde#510027: MS Money import: Investment transactions not
grouped
* kde#510115: MS Money import: Ignore (/import?) Classifications
* kde#492495: Empty New Account after CSV Import
* kde#491382: Wishlist: Add an option for work days in Schedule
Transactions
* Correction bug: Increase width of unit combo box
* Correction bug: Not possible to create SEK and NOK units
because they have the same symbol. Fiw by using
- Drop patch:
* 0001-Fix-build-with-Qt-6.10.patch
-------------------------------------------------------------------
Mon Oct 13 11:15:16 UTC 2025 - Christophe Marin <christophe@krop.fr>
- Add patch:
* 0001-Fix-build-with-Qt-6.10.patch
-------------------------------------------------------------------
Sat Apr 26 07:47:17 UTC 2025 - Christophe Marin <christophe@krop.fr>

View File

@@ -1,7 +1,7 @@
#
# spec file for package skrooge
#
# Copyright (c) 2025 SUSE LLC
# Copyright (c) 2026 SUSE LLC and contributors
# Copyright (c) 2008 - 2012 Sascha Manns <saigkill@opensuse.org>
#
# All modifications and additions to the file contributed by third parties
@@ -26,7 +26,7 @@
%define with_qtwebengine 1
%endif
Name: skrooge
Version: 25.4.0
Version: 26.1.20
Release: 0
Summary: A Personal Finance Management Tool
License: GPL-3.0-only
@@ -38,15 +38,15 @@ Source1: https://download.kde.org/stable/skrooge/%{name}-%{version}.tar.x
# https://invent.kde.org/sysadmin/release-keyring/-/blob/master/keys/smankowski@key2.asc?ref_type=heads
Source2: skrooge.keyring
%endif
BuildRequires: kf6-breeze-icons
BuildRequires: kf6-extra-cmake-modules >= %{kf6_version}
BuildRequires: fdupes
BuildRequires: hicolor-icon-theme
BuildRequires: kf6-breeze-icons
BuildRequires: kf6-extra-cmake-modules >= %{kf6_version}
BuildRequires: libofx-devel
BuildRequires: pkgconfig
BuildRequires: qt6-sql-private-devel >= %{qt6_version}
BuildRequires: shared-mime-info
BuildRequires: sqlcipher-devel
BuildRequires: pkgconfig
BuildRequires: cmake(KF6Archive) >= %{kf6_version}
BuildRequires: cmake(KF6ColorScheme) >= %{kf6_version}
BuildRequires: cmake(KF6Completion) >= %{kf6_version}
@@ -142,8 +142,6 @@ sed -i 's#env python3#python3#' %{buildroot}%{_kf6_sharedir}/skrooge/*.py
%{_kf6_libdir}/libskgbasegui.so.*
%{_kf6_libdir}/libskgbasemodeler.so.*
%{_kf6_notificationsdir}/skrooge.notifyrc
# %%{_kf6_plugindir}/designer/libskgbankguidesigner.so
# %%{_kf6_plugindir}/designer/libskgbaseguidesigner.so
%dir %{_kf6_plugindir}/kf6/ktexttemplate
%{_kf6_plugindir}/kf6/ktexttemplate/grantlee_skgfilters.so
%{_kf6_plugindir}/skg_gui/